Transaction e17b8800862ae7371d205ea88463f197e539440000dcc78a0b9bbe67e8ea7a5d
1 Input
1 Output
-
e17b8800862ae7371d205ea88463f197e539440000dcc78a0b9bbe67e8ea7a5d:0
- value
- 462883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c5ebed7af98d1317c270f20a71c919735e10325 OP_EQUAL
- address
- 3Ba2QHvu8RvVWkeKyBaspDW8KUbaVzrFdH